>     This patch adds checking whether the related Tx or Rx queue has been
>     setupped in the queue-related API functions to avoid illegal address
>     access. And validity check of the queue_id is also added in the API
>     functions rte_eth_dev_rx_intr_enable and rte_eth_dev_rx_intr_disable.

> Hi Xavier,
>
> How about having two common functions which validate RXQ/TXQ ids and 
> whether it has been set up or not like below. This helps avoiding lot 
> of duplicate code:
>
> static inline int
> rte_eth_dev_validate_rx_queue(uint16_t port_id, uint16_t rx_queue_id)
> {
>         struct rte_eth_dev *dev;
>
>         RTE_ETH_VALID_PORTID_OR_ERR_RET(port_id, -EINVAL);
>
>         dev = &rte_eth_devices[port_id];
>
>         if (rx_queue_id >= dev->data->nb_rx_queues) {
>                 RTE_ETHDEV_LOG(ERR, "Invalid RX queue_id=%u\n", 
> rx_queue_id);
>                 return -EINVAL;
>         }
>
>        if (dev->data->rx_queues[rx_queue_id] == NULL) {
>                RTE_ETHDEV_LOG(ERR,
>                               "Queue %u of device with port_id=%u has 
> not been setup\n",
>                               rx_queue_id, port_id);
>                return -EINVAL;
>        }
>
>        return 0;
> }
>
I fixed it in V2.
